Key topics covered in the Prodigy Program so far include fundamental endgames such as K Q vs. K, K R vs. K, K B B vs. K, and other basic endgames involving edge pawns. Several lessons have also focused on tactics, forcing moves, basic planning, general principles of chess, and how to calculate and analyze.
During the January 2015 month of the Prodigy Program, the material in the 900 and 1200 sections will continue to focus on tactics and endgames with some coverage of openings. The 900 and 1200 sections will be different in terms of rigor for obvious reasons.
